Madilyne

Feminine diminutive form of Madeline meaning "high tower" or "woman from Magdala".

Name Census estimates that about 323 living Americans carry the first name Madilyne. The name is used almost exclusively for girls. The average person named Madilyne today is around 17 years old, and the year with the single highest number of Madilyne births was 2008 (24 babies).

Madilyne: popularity over time

The SSA tracks Madilyne from the 1990s through to the 2020s, spanning 4 decades of birth certificate data. The biggest single decade for the name was the 2000s, with 126 total registrations. Usage has dropped considerably from its 2000s peak. The most recent decade brought in only a fraction of the registrations that the name once attracted.

Meaning and history of Madilyne

Madilyne is a feminine given name with roots tracing back to the Old French language. It is a variant spelling of the name Madeleine, which originated from the Biblical name Magdalene. Magdalene was derived from a Greek name referring to someone from the town of Magdala in ancient Israel.

The name Madilyne gained popularity in medieval Europe, particularly in France and England. It was often associated with Mary Magdalene, a prominent figure in the New Testament who was a devoted follower of Jesus Christ. The name carried connotations of devotion, loyalty, and spiritual strength.

One of the earliest recorded instances of the name Madilyne can be found in a 13th-century French manuscript, where it was spelled "Madeline." Over time, various spelling variations emerged, including Madeleine, Madeline, and Madilyne.

How many people in the U.S. are named Madilyne?

Name Census puts the figure at roughly 323 living Americans. We arrive at this by taking every SSA birth registration for Madilyne going back to 1880 and adjusting each cohort for expected survival using CDC actuarial life tables. The result is an age-weighted living-bearer count, not a raw birth total. That works out to about 1 in 1,061,159 US residents.

Where does this data come from?

First-name figures come from the Social Security Administration's national baby name files, which cover every name on a birth certificate from 1880 to 2024. Living-bearer estimates layer in CDC actuarial life tables broken out by sex to account for mortality. The population baseline (342,754,338) is the Census Bureau's latest national estimate.
